2. Fees & Payments:
2.1 MyMiniFactory charges a commission platform fee depending on the tier selected (see Store Manager page) on all revenue generated, plus payment processing fees as per below:
a.1) Standard rate on payments inside the USA: 2.9% + $0.30 per successful payment over $3.
a.2) Standard rate on purchases outside the USA: 3.9% + $0.30 per successful payment over $3.
b) Micropayment rate: 5% + $0.10 per successful payment $3 or less.
c) Please note that all payment processing fees are applicable on the gross object price paid with VAT/Sales Tax included.
d) Payment processing fees are calculated on the overall successful payment amount transacted with MyMiniFactory. If the overall successful payment amount exceeds $3, Creators are charged the Standard rate (non-micropayment) payment processing fees on their object(s) sold, irrespective of whether their proportion of the overall successful payment is more or less than $3.
Example: Calculation of Earnings and Sales Tax / VAT on MyMiniFactory (Texas, USA-based customer):
e) Detailed example of how Earnings and Sales Tax / VAT will be calculated on MyMiniFactory (Texas, USA based customer):
A) Object price = $10 (without sales tax / VAT)
A.1) Applicable sales tax / VAT of 6.25% = $0.63 (total price paid is $10 + $0.63 = $10.63)
A.2) Payment processing fees = $0.61 (calculated on the gross $10.63 amount (including sales tax / VAT), fees are 2.9% + $0.30)
A.3) MyMiniFactory 15% (using Upcoming Tier) commission platform fee = $1.50 (calculated on the $10 object price (excluding sales tax / VAT))
Creator net payout earnings: $7.89 (= A - C - D) (= $10 - $0.61 - $1.50)
(Payment processing fees are calculated on the overall successful payment amount transacted with MyMiniFactory.)
MyMiniFactory collects the sales tax / VAT that the customer originally paid ($0.63 in this example) and sends it to the relevant authority. The figures used in this example are rounded to 2 decimal places.
2.2 Creator Payout fees charged by MyMiniFactory = $0.
2.3 Creator Payout frequency is dependent on the tier selected (see Store Manager page). For Upcoming creators, the frequency is once a month on the 28th. For Pro and Studio creators, the frequency is twice a month on the 14th and 28th. If the payout date lands on a non-business day, the payment will be made on the next working day.
2.4 All fees and payments are clearly displayed in a dedicated creators Statistics page within your Profile.
2.5 All transactions for The Adventure subscribers benefit from a 10% discount on Store objects. The discount is provided at a cost to MyMiniFactory and creators will earn the commission as if the discount did not occur.

3. VAT/Sales Tax:
3.1 MyMiniFactory manages all VAT/Sales Tax on behalf of the Creator. We collect and remit the applicable VAT/Sales Tax on your behalf to the relevant tax authorities. We are doing this to make matters as easy as possible for the Creators on MyMiniFactory.
3.2 Your object for sale advertises the price without VAT/Sales Tax and then if a customer is from an applicable country or region at the checkout stage the relevant VAT/Sales Tax due is added to the object price. For example, a Creator inputs the object price without VAT/Sales Tax at $10. A customer is from the UK and a 20% VAT rate is applicable. The price the customer sees and pays at the checkout stage would therefore be $12.
3.3 The MyMiniFactory commission platform fee is applicable on the object price without VAT/Sales Tax included.
3.4 Payment processing fees are applicable on the gross object price paid with VAT/Sales Tax included.
3.5 If you are resident in the UK and registered for VAT, we ask that you please provide us with your valid VAT number or contact your Creator Relations consultant for further information.

4. Tribes:
In order to maintain and promote a sustainable community, we ask all Creators to fulfil as much as possible, if not exceed, the expectations promised via their Tribe subscription. We advise all Tribers to first contact their respective Tribe creator if they are unhappy with the level of service being provided. All refunds, for the time being, will need to be requested via MyMiniFactory,
who then action the request on your behalf if it is deemed satisfactory.
4.1. As a Triber (Tribe subscriber), your Tribe Subscription will automatically renew on the 1st day of each month and will continue unless paused or canceled by you or us in accordance with these terms and conditions. Each subscription period is one calendar month, starting from when you first subscribe. For example, if your Tribe Subscription is accepted on March 4th, it will be valid until March 31st. The recurring monthly subscription fee will then be charged on the 1st for the next subscription month, which will run until April 1st. An active Tribe can be set on pause by the Creator, which would also pause your billing cycle. You will receive an email notification 72 hours (UTC) before the end of the month before the pause. During the pause of your subscription, your Tribe Subscription is still considered active, and you reserve the right to access any Tribe offer(s) provided by the Creator, if any. However, the Creator reserves the right not to provide any Tribe offer(s) when they pause their Tribe. If you are on an Annual Subscription, you will be partially refunded by the end of the paused month. An email notification will be sent to you once the refund is issued, and this will be conducted by the MyMiniFactory team.
Please reach out to us via the contact us form if you have any difficulties.
4.2. As a Tribe Creator, inorder to have this feature activated for your account, reach out to your Creator Relations Representative, or email creator-relations@myminifactory.com.
Once you access the feature, you are allowed to pause or extend the pausing of your Tribe no later than 72 hours (UTC) before the end of the month. You are also allowed to cancel your pause or pause extension request no later than 72 hours (UTC) before the end of the month. You can only pause the next month, one month at a time. If the scheduled pause proceeds, your Tribe will be paused 72 hours (UTC) before the end of the month. Once pause is activated, no users can join your Tribe. During the pausing, your Tribers' subscriptions will have the ability to access:
- Distributed objects, if any
- Available Triber discounts to apply to your store objects, if any
- Tribes-only posts, if any
